Dickinson's network of international offices reflects the global nature of our work; the Monaco office focuses on the needs of our yacht and superyacht client base, and our offices in Piraeus, Singapore and Hong Kong specialise in the marine, trade and energy markets. Outside of the shipping world, Hill Dickinson was somewhat of a pioneer: in the 1930s murder trial ofWilliam Herbert Wallace, the firm brought the first successful appealin legal history that was allowed after re-examination of evidence. Outside of its Liverpool HQ, the firm has three other offices in the UK: London (opened in 1929), Manchester (1997)and Leeds (2017).
